Location: Farm has good location at the northeast corner of U.S. 22 & Johnson Road 6 miles east of Washington Court House, Oh at 7015 U.S. 22 NE.
Legal: 170.28 acres, Marion Township, Fayette County, Ohio known as the Harper Farm.
Land: 135.73 acres of productive copland (80%). FSA cropland acs. 125.73. Approximately 33 acres pasture, with the balance in building sites, road frontage, grass area, and cropland is randomly tiled. Soils are approximately 15% black and 85% clay. Soil types are Brookston, Crosby, Celina, and Miami.
Improvements: 1 story 1586 sq.ft., 6 room, 2 bath one-story house and 4 barns.
Taxes: $2,432.70 annually.
Price: $3,985.00 per acre.
